First, it's important to understand what 'walk-in' typically means for an optometry practice. While many clinics primarily operate by appointment to ensure dedicated time for each patient, several in the Tuscaloosa County area do accommodate same-day or urgent care visits. These are often for pressing concerns like sudden vision changes, eye pain, redness, foreign object removal, or urgent prescription needs. For routine comprehensive eye exams, scheduling an appointment is still the best way to guarantee a convenient time slot, but knowing which offices have flexibility can be a lifesaver during a minor crisis.
When looking for a walk-in optometrist near you in Northport, consider a few practical tips. Always call ahead first. Even clinics that accept walk-ins may have varying availability based on the day's schedule. A quick phone call can save you a trip and confirm they can address your specific concern. Explain your symptoms clearly—this helps the staff determine if you need to be seen immediately. For true emergencies, such as chemical burns, sudden vision loss, or severe trauma, proceed directly to the nearest emergency room.

To make your search easier, keep a shortlist of a few local optometry offices that you've confirmed offer same-day care options. Check their websites or social media pages for any posted policies about walk-in hours. Building a relationship with a local optometrist, even for your routine care, means you'll have a trusted professional to turn to when urgent needs arise. They'll already have your health history on file, allowing for more efficient and informed care during an unexpected visit.
